Leading Admiralty, Shipping & Maritime Lawyers – Australia, 2026

The 2026 listing of leading Australian Admiralty, Shipping & Maritime Lawyers details solicitors practising within the areas of admiralty, shipping and maritime matters in Australian legal market who have been identified by their peers for their expertise and abilities in these areas.
